HourStack is a SaaS/enterprise product focused on team time management. Its website repeatedly emphasizes its mission to help teams of all sizes plan, track, and prioritize time. The most important recent change is that the HourStack team has joined ClickUp and is now building scheduling and time-tracking capabilities into the ClickUp platform. From a procurement perspective, HourStack should therefore no longer be viewed simply as a standalone time management tool, but rather as part of—or a source for—ClickUp’s resource management and time-tracking capabilities.
The core modules confirmed from the captured content include time planning, time tracking, time prioritization, and the scheduling and time-tracking features currently being built within ClickUp. The text says it is designed for “teams of all sizes,” indicating that the product was originally positioned for team-based use cases. However, it does not disclose specific details about collaboration mechanisms, permission systems, approval workflows, reporting, project integrations, or resource capacity management. Third-party integrations, APIs, developer support, data security and compliance, cloud deployment, and self-hosting are also not mentioned in the main website copy.
The currently captured website content does not include any plan details, pricing, free tier, trial period, or payment method information. Since the website mainly presents the acquisition announcement, companies evaluating a purchase should further confirm whether standalone HourStack subscriptions are still available, how existing accounts will be migrated, and which ClickUp plans now include the relevant capabilities.
The main advantages are that the product has a clear direction, focusing on team time planning and time tracking. After joining ClickUp, its features may benefit from a larger user base and stronger platform resources, while the original team continues to contribute to ClickUp’s resource management product development. The drawbacks are also clear: the status of the standalone product is uncertain, and the website lacks key procurement information for enterprises, including pricing, security, permissions, integrations, and support. This creates a relatively high level of evaluation uncertainty.
HourStack is better suited to teams that already use or plan to use ClickUp, especially organizations that want to manage scheduling and work hours within a single project management platform.
